Linux developers are currently hard at work patching a high-severity vulnerability that could potentially spell trouble for users. This vulnerability, known as CVE-2023-40547, poses a significant risk by enabling the installation of malware that operates at the firmware level. This means that infections could potentially gain access to the deepest recesses of a device, where they can lurk undetected and prove incredibly challenging to remove.
The crux of the issue lies within shim, a key component in Linux that kicks into gear early in the boot process, even before the operating system itself springs into action. Shim plays a vital role in the realm of secure boot, a critical security feature integrated into most modern devices to ensure that each step of the boot-up sequence can be traced back to a legitimate, trusted source. However, with this vulnerability, attackers could effectively bypass this safeguard by injecting malicious firmware during the initial stages of booting, prior to the handoff from the Unified Extensible Firmware Interface firmware to the operating system.
What makes this vulnerability particularly insidious is its exploitation through a buffer overflow, a type of coding flaw that permits attackers to execute their own code at will. This exploit opens the door to a range of nefarious activities, all contingent on the successful compromise of either the device itself or the server/network from which it boots. Essentially, this vulnerability represents a potential backdoor for attackers to undermine the security of a system, paving the way for a host of malicious activities.
While the idea of attackers gaining control over a device at such a fundamental level may sound alarming, the reality is that achieving this level of access typically requires a series of intricate steps. In most cases, attackers would need to have already secured administrative control through exploiting a separate vulnerability within the operating system. Once this hurdle is cleared, the possibilities for executing malicious actions become vast and concerning.
In response to this threat, Linux developers are diligently working on patches to fortify the system against potential exploits. By addressing this vulnerability promptly and effectively, they aim to bolster the security of Linux distributions and shield users from the pernicious reach of malware that seeks to embed itself deep within the firmware of devices. Vigilance, swift action, and a robust defense strategy are paramount in safeguarding against such vulnerabilities and ensuring the integrity and security of the Linux ecosystem.